OBSERVANCE OF ANZAC DAY, APRIL 25, 1925. ’ Friday, 24th* April.—The 7.10 . p.m. (limited) and 7.45 p.m. j Auckland-Wellington express , trains will NOT run. Saturday, 25th April (Anzac Day).—The ordinary time-table will be suspended, except that the express train ex Wellington arriving Frankton 3.35 a.m. and Auckland 6.38 a.m. WILL run. Sunday, 26th April.—The express train ex Wellington arriving Frankton 3.35 a.m. and Auckland 6.38 a.m. will NOT run. HORAHIA DRAINAGE DISTRICT. Notice is hereby given.1.
